Admitting that you've been tabs on 2023's social media 'beef' of the year so far is nothing to be ashamed of.

The 'eyebrow raising' drama started with Kylie Jenner and Selena Gomez, who is now the most followed woman on Instagram, with the Kardashian sister forced to settle for second place.

Back in February, Selena, 30, took to Instagram to share that she had over-laminated her own brows.

Nothing too dramatic, however, shortly after, Kylie hopped on Instagram to share a zoomed in image on her brows with the caption: "This was an accident ?????"

But wait, it get's worse.

Jenner then shared a snap of her and Hailey Bieber, who is also a key component in this saga, both zooming on their eyebrows in a FaceTime video.

Advert

The two were accused of being childish, which prompted the make-up mogul to deny #eyebrowgate allegations.

"This is reaching," Kylie wrote.

"No shade towards Selena ever and I didn’t see her eyebrow posts! U guys are making something out of nothing. This is silly."

However, this 'beef' is actually more complex than you might have assumed, as back in January, Selena was unfortunately body-shamed after photos of her in a bikini were shared online.

And Selena fought back against the negative comments, saying: "I love my body."

Not too long after, Hailey uploaded a TikTok video with friends Kendall Jenner and Justine Skye, miming along to a popular soundbite that goes: "And I'm not saying she deserved it, but God's timing is always right."

Although the video has since been deleted, some fans believed it was a dig at Selena.

Advert

Hailey has denied the allegations, saying: "I never comment on this type of thing but we were just having a girls night and did a random TikTok sound for fun, it's not directed at anyone."

But wait - there's more.

You might remember when Selena took a brief break from social media in February, telling her fans that 'this was silly' and that she was 'too old for this'.

Before her announcement, the singer was seen sticking up for Taylor Swift after a video of Hailey appearing to criticise her resurfaced.

The clip shows Hailey and Method Man, who used to co-host the show Drop The Mic.

Method Man joked about Swift's songs in the clip, teasing a 'rap battle full of the meanest lyrics about a celebrity since Taylor Swift's last album'.

As Method Man mentioned the 'Shake It Off' singer, Hailey stuck out her tongue and pretended to put her finger in her throat as if to make herself sick.

After the clip was shared online, Gomez defended Swift and wrote: "So sorry, my best friend is and continues to be one of the best in the game."
